HTML5 <head> 标签
实例
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>文档标题</title> </head> <body> 文档内容...... </body> </html>
运行实例 »
点击 "运行实例" 按钮查看在线实例
(更多实例见页面底部)
浏览器支持
所有主流浏览器都支持 <head> 标签。
标签定义及使用说明
<head> 元素是所有头部元素的容器。
<head> 元素必须包含文档的标题(title),可以包含脚本、样式、meta 信息 以及其他更多的信息。
以下列出的元素能被用在 <head> 元素内部:
<title> (在头部中,这个元素是必需的)
<style>
<base>
<link>
<meta>
<script>
<noscript>
HTML 4.01 与 HTML5之间的差异
HTML5 不再支持 profile 属性。
属性
属性 | 值 | 描述 |
---|---|---|
profile | URL | HTML5 不支持。规定文档 URL 的一系列规则。这些规则能被浏览器识别并且准确读取 <meta> 标签的内容属性中的信息。 |
全局属性
<head> 标签支持 HTML 的全局属性。
实例
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>html(html.cn)</title> <base href="http://www.html.cn/images/" target="_blank"> </head> <body> <p><img src="//www.html.cn/statics/images/html/logo.png" > - 注意这里我们设置了图片的相对地址。能正常显示是因为我们在 head 部分设置了 base 标签,该标签指定了页面上所有链接的默认 URL,所以该图片的访问地址为 "http://www.w3cschool.cn/statics/images/logo.png"</p> <p><a href="http://www.html.cn/">html.cn</a> - 注意这个链接会在新窗口打开,即便它没有 target="_blank" 属性。因为在 base 标签里我们已经设置了 target 属性的值为 "_blank"。</p> </body> </html>
运行实例 »
点击 "运行实例" 按钮查看在线实例
本例演示如何使用 <base> 标签规定页面中所有链接的默认 URL 和默认 target。
实例
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>html(html.cn)</title> <style type="text/css"> h1 {color:red;} p {color:blue;} </style> </head> <body> <h1>这是一个标题</h1> <p>这是一个段落。</p> <div style="width:0px;height:0px;position:absolute;top:-999px;left:-999px;"><object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" id="erroralert" width="1px" height="1px"><param name="AllowScriptAccess" value="always"/><param name="movie" value="http://tongji.baidu.com/logstat.swf"/><embed name="erroralert" width="1px" height="1px" allowscriptaccess="always" align="middle" src="//tongji.baidu.com/logstat.swf" type="application/x-shockwave-flash"/></object></div><div style="width:0px;height:0px;position:absolute;top:-999px;left:-999px;"><object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" id="erroralert1" width="1px" height="1px"><param name="AllowScriptAccess" value="always"/><param name="movie" value="http://tongji.baidu.com/logstat1.swf"/><embed name="erroralert1" width="1px" height="1px" allowscriptaccess="always" align="middle" src="//tongji.baidu.com/logstat1.swf" type="application/x-shockwave-flash"/></object></div></body> </html>
运行实例 »
点击 "运行实例" 按钮查看在线实例
本例演示如何在 <head> 部分添加样式信息。
实例
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>html(html.cn)</title> <link rel="stylesheet" type="text/css" href="/statics/demosource/styles.css"> </head> <body> <h1>我是通过样式文件 styles.css 渲染后显示的。</h1> <p>我也是。</p> </body> </html>
运行实例 »
点击 "运行实例" 按钮查看在线实例
本例演示如何使用 <link> 标签链接到一个外部样式表。
实例
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>文档标题</title> </head> <body> 文档内容...... </body> </html>
运行实例 »
点击 "运行实例" 按钮查看在线实例
(更多实例见页面底部)
浏览器支持
所有主流浏览器都支持 <head> 标签。
标签定义及使用说明
<head> 元素是所有头部元素的容器。
<head> 元素必须包含文档的标题(title),可以包含脚本、样式、meta 信息 以及其他更多的信息。
以下列出的元素能被用在 <head> 元素内部:
<title> (在头部中,这个元素是必需的)
<style>
<base>
<link>
<meta>
<script>
<noscript>
HTML 4.01 与 HTML5之间的差异
HTML5 不再支持 profile 属性。
属性
属性 | 值 | 描述 |
---|---|---|
profile | URL | HTML5 不支持。规定文档 URL 的一系列规则。这些规则能被浏览器识别并且准确读取 <meta> 标签的内容属性中的信息。 |
全局属性
<head> 标签支持 HTML 的全局属性。
实例
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>html(html.cn)</title> <base href="http://www.html.cn/images/" target="_blank"> </head> <body> <p><img src="//www.html.cn/statics/images/html/logo.png" > - 注意这里我们设置了图片的相对地址。能正常显示是因为我们在 head 部分设置了 base 标签,该标签指定了页面上所有链接的默认 URL,所以该图片的访问地址为 "http://www.w3cschool.cn/statics/images/logo.png"</p> <p><a href="http://www.html.cn/">html.cn</a> - 注意这个链接会在新窗口打开,即便它没有 target="_blank" 属性。因为在 base 标签里我们已经设置了 target 属性的值为 "_blank"。</p> </body> </html>
运行实例 »
点击 "运行实例" 按钮查看在线实例
本例演示如何使用 <base> 标签规定页面中所有链接的默认 URL 和默认 target。
实例
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>html(html.cn)</title> <style type="text/css"> h1 {color:red;} p {color:blue;} </style> </head> <body> <h1>这是一个标题</h1> <p>这是一个段落。</p> <div style="width:0px;height:0px;position:absolute;top:-999px;left:-999px;"><object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" id="erroralert" width="1px" height="1px"><param name="AllowScriptAccess" value="always"/><param name="movie" value="http://tongji.baidu.com/logstat.swf"/><embed name="erroralert" width="1px" height="1px" allowscriptaccess="always" align="middle" src="//tongji.baidu.com/logstat.swf" type="application/x-shockwave-flash"/></object></div><div style="width:0px;height:0px;position:absolute;top:-999px;left:-999px;"><object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" id="erroralert1" width="1px" height="1px"><param name="AllowScriptAccess" value="always"/><param name="movie" value="http://tongji.baidu.com/logstat1.swf"/><embed name="erroralert1" width="1px" height="1px" allowscriptaccess="always" align="middle" src="//tongji.baidu.com/logstat1.swf" type="application/x-shockwave-flash"/></object></div></body> </html>
运行实例 »
点击 "运行实例" 按钮查看在线实例
本例演示如何在 <head> 部分添加样式信息。
实例
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>html(html.cn)</title> <link rel="stylesheet" type="text/css" href="/statics/demosource/styles.css"> </head> <body> <h1>我是通过样式文件 styles.css 渲染后显示的。</h1> <p>我也是。</p> </body> </html>
运行实例 »
点击 "运行实例" 按钮查看在线实例
本例演示如何使用 <link> 标签链接到一个外部样式表。